aboutsummaryrefslogtreecommitdiffstats
path: root/main/lua5.2
diff options
context:
space:
mode:
authorJakub Jirutka <jakub@jirutka.cz>2017-12-29 01:40:02 +0100
committerJakub Jirutka <jakub@jirutka.cz>2017-12-29 01:42:18 +0100
commita76fbf4b725d1df81ebd593d8913781882a4e0fc (patch)
tree426d0e5d6be186f0efc3401e06ede5fb0d34261e /main/lua5.2
parent961c328693591e7ee0f64b2e40cc133a8390c03b (diff)
downloadaports-a76fbf4b725d1df81ebd593d8913781882a4e0fc.tar.bz2
aports-a76fbf4b725d1df81ebd593d8913781882a4e0fc.tar.xz
main/lua5.2: add /usr/share/lua/common to LUA_PATH
Diffstat (limited to 'main/lua5.2')
-rw-r--r--main/lua5.2/APKBUILD10
-rw-r--r--main/lua5.2/lua-5.2-module_paths.patch9
2 files changed, 8 insertions, 11 deletions
diff --git a/main/lua5.2/APKBUILD b/main/lua5.2/APKBUILD
index 3998fd2ac7..3acf528eee 100644
--- a/main/lua5.2/APKBUILD
+++ b/main/lua5.2/APKBUILD
@@ -2,7 +2,7 @@
pkgname=lua5.2
pkgver=5.2.4
_luaver=${pkgname#lua}
-pkgrel=4
+pkgrel=5
pkgdesc="Powerful light-weight programming language"
url="https://www.lua.org/"
arch="all"
@@ -138,12 +138,6 @@ libs() {
mv "$pkgdir"/usr/lib "$subpkgdir"/usr/
}
-md5sums="913fdb32207046b273fdb17aad70be13 lua-5.2.4.tar.gz
-04df4ba7df30c617bd101aba3541c06d lua-5.2-make.patch
-c34dc7623ff3c8b9ec9dab6499c841e2 lua-5.2-module_paths.patch"
-sha256sums="b9e2e4aad6789b3b63a056d442f7b39f0ecfca3ae0f1fc0ae4e9614401b69f4b lua-5.2.4.tar.gz
-eef3724469c62627722435b4cf30db4ebb1230e5512da11d9b9431a29b02955a lua-5.2-make.patch
-790802a33b2200064e92abfdd0faae560a2af903ae78e5b79661f4b8e19d2bb7 lua-5.2-module_paths.patch"
sha512sums="cd77148aba4b707b6c159758b5e8444e04f968092eb98f6b4c405b2fb647e709370d5a8dcf604176101d3407e196a7433b5dcdce4fe9605c76191d3649d61a8c lua-5.2.4.tar.gz
f1d5e0a1db0790fae82dd6de5742631c6c4ca009752630a612d864746990a00c8f2eacc7dbf07be2bce94d04da4ad185ed10dc317d7bf093df698bf84fea682e lua-5.2-make.patch
-062eb61132a60c10358590db30e8f5698ceb088b94bdcff840423c70c7bcdac4fe96c3ad35a068b795953f25712f28a4e0efd7a7bb29a0360285bf2c8bf7c416 lua-5.2-module_paths.patch"
+1665c896925357c1f0404697f5f479c2928fb709b6f4464dc422027245200891ef714edf8fc1456ba3e5b0806a42ca2c40f903afa9584cd59e40f5418144c073 lua-5.2-module_paths.patch"
diff --git a/main/lua5.2/lua-5.2-module_paths.patch b/main/lua5.2/lua-5.2-module_paths.patch
index 3d0b3c21b6..58237b6fae 100644
--- a/main/lua5.2/lua-5.2-module_paths.patch
+++ b/main/lua5.2/lua-5.2-module_paths.patch
@@ -2,21 +2,24 @@ diff --git a/src/luaconf.h b/src/luaconf.h
index df802c9..f8f64e0 100644
--- a/src/luaconf.h
+++ b/src/luaconf.h
-@@ -101,13 +101,19 @@
+@@ -101,13 +99,22 @@
#define LUA_VDIR LUA_VERSION_MAJOR "." LUA_VERSION_MINOR "/"
#define LUA_ROOT "/usr/local/"
+#define LUA_ROOT2 "/usr/"
#define LUA_LDIR LUA_ROOT "share/lua/" LUA_VDIR
+#define LUA_LDIR2 LUA_ROOT2 "share/lua/" LUA_VDIR
++#define LUA_LDIR3 LUA_ROOT2 "share/common/"
#define LUA_CDIR LUA_ROOT "lib/lua/" LUA_VDIR
+#define LUA_CDIR2 LUA_ROOT2 "lib/lua/" LUA_VDIR
#define LUA_PATH_DEFAULT \
LUA_LDIR"?.lua;" LUA_LDIR"?/init.lua;" \
- LUA_CDIR"?.lua;" LUA_CDIR"?/init.lua;" "./?.lua"
++ LUA_CDIR"?.lua;" LUA_CDIR"?/init.lua;" \
+ LUA_LDIR2"?.lua;" LUA_LDIR2"?/init.lua;" \
-+ LUA_CDIR"?.lua;" LUA_CDIR"?/init.lua;" "./?.lua;" \
-+ LUA_CDIR2"?.lua;" LUA_CDIR2"?/init.lua;" "./?.lua"
++ LUA_CDIR2"?.lua;" LUA_CDIR2"?/init.lua;" \
++ LUA_LDIR3"?.lua;" LUA_LDIR3"?/init.lua;" \
++ "./?.lua"
#define LUA_CPATH_DEFAULT \
- LUA_CDIR"?.so;" LUA_CDIR"loadall.so;" "./?.so"
+ LUA_CDIR"?.so;" LUA_CDIR"loadall.so;" \